i dont rly agree that health isnt an issue it just depends on the character, jill is the kind of character that suffers the most from having low health imo. She has no long range options and has trouble getting in on zoning, low health means that getting chipped or hit with projectiles is more dangerous. Also jill’s TOD options are pretty weak, 900K+ health characters can be hard to kill without very specific assists or using 3 meters, so in a lot of cases they can TOD you but you wont be able to do it yourself. I still dont understand why jill only has 850k when viper has 900K and morrigan has 950K.
As for anchor jill, i feel like she would’ve been a good anchor if she had less recovery on MGS. As it is right now with XF3 she can only follow up MGS with a combo in very specific situations (in the corner at SJ height). She already has TODs in XF3 that dont use meter (and build a lot), so if she had more practical MGS follow ups you can just use MGS to catch zoning/run-away characters and you should be able to build enough meter through her combos to use it repeatedly.

i say go with arrow kick definitely, leveling up frank is too important to not use it. Cross over counters are great and all but its still very limiting when they have no good uses as assists.
I agree, Arrow is really good because you can level up frank with it, and jill in arrow kick is like a huge priority Wall bouncing projectile and allows huge pressure with Frank’s Zombie Swing. COuple the Zombie swing with his Zombie THROW( Charged move)+ her Arrow kick and it makes sweet zoning that allows frank to move in if for some reason he’s on point.
Cartwheel allows level 4 as well, but the only problem is that it uses a groundbounce, I made a guide that had several ways to get around that and still get to level 4.

Most/all close range fights are in jill’s favor because of somersault, against haggar just somersault all day, it shouldnt be a problem because as long as you leave a small distance between you and haggar then all of his moves are slow and telegraphed. He needs to be pretty close for lariat to connect, everything else he has gets blown up by somersault. It only gets tricky when they’re being backed by a good projectile assist, in which case you can either use her dash to avoid the projectile or use you’re own assists to even it out, if haggar catches one of your assists without jill dont hesitate to burn a meter on MGS.
If he has downloaded jill’s gameplan he’s not going to to Jump+pipe so often, so your going to have to bait out his lariat alot more+ IF he has bars WAIT TILL THE LAST POSSIBLE FRAME and punish his Rapid Fist with a hyper.
Best advice is to go into training and just practice 22Sing everything; flip kicks, Carwheel, Arrow Kick,etc. From there, practice 22s–> 6 for movement and 22s–>96S for the offensive overhead.
Once you get 22Sing down, learn how to 22S somersault EVERYTHING. ’
Usually however, it’s pipe+Plus Projectile. Somersault his pipe then IMMEDIATELY MGS to catch his assist then Xfactor to take them both out. Sometimes as well, you can just MGS since he’s in the air if the assists are coming toward you too quickly. Watch out though, MGS Xfactor has to be timed quite nicely because sometimes you get an air Xfactor which jill doesn’t really benefit from. You can also Double Somersault, which is a harder tactic (22S,Somersault,cancel Somesault into 22S,Somesault again before she leaves the ground for more invincibile frames) to negate the beam. You can also use your assists (watch for lariat) to pressure him into not calling assists.
The problem with fighting haggar is going to reside in trying to overhead him. When they download your gameplan, they know your going to go for a overhead, so they usually lariat,xfactor. If you went for the overhead, you can cancel it into her double knee Drop H and follow up. Like said before, if you know they’re going to go for this and you attempted it, bait it out cancel back into feral stance, somersault,etc.
When you are near him and he calls an assist+he’s jumping piping, that’s your cue to go on the offensive and take a happy birthday.
